Output aa93c0e47e2c92f15563669df1faf8b68adfd21dd8f45e6d7cf7ff41f95afdd3:1

value
25227503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c6823fdb3d0081aea8e31a51d36b386c9829aa9 OP_EQUAL
address
3BaDf5PXwcgLQqspTsFwEmUMR3s7SxMAZH
transaction
aa93c0e47e2c92f15563669df1faf8b68adfd21dd8f45e6d7cf7ff41f95afdd3
confirmations
502610
spent
true